Source Insight中文网站 > 最新资讯 > SourceInsight怎么配置环境SourceInsight如何进行个性化定制
教程中心分类
SourceInsight怎么配置环境SourceInsight如何进行个性化定制
发布时间:2025/02/21 13:43:22

在软件开发和代码分析领域,SourceInsight是一款备受青睐的工具。它强大的代码浏览、分析和编辑功能,能极大提升开发者的工作效率。然而,要充分发挥SourceInsight的优势,正确配置环境和进行个性化定制至关重要。接下来,我们将详细探讨SourceInsight的环境配置和个性化定制方法,同时解决一个具体的技术问题。

一、SourceInsight怎么配置环境

1.软件安装

首先,从官方渠道获取SourceInsight的安装包。运行安装程序后,按照提示逐步操作。一般来说,只需选择安装路径,然后等待安装完成即可。安装完成后,首次启动SourceInsight,可能会出现一些设置向导,可根据自身需求进行基本设置,如选择界面语言等。

2.项目创建与代码导入

打开SourceInsight后,通过菜单栏中的“Project”选项,选择“NewProject”来创建一个新的项目。为项目命名并选择合适的保存路径。接着,在弹出的“AddandRemoveProjectFiles”窗口中,使用“Add...”按钮将需要分析的代码文件或整个文件夹添加到项目中。SourceInsight会自动对导入的代码进行解析,这个过程可能需要一些时间,尤其是对于大型项目。

3.编译器与工具配置

SourceInsight支持与多种编译器和工具集成。在菜单栏中选择“Options”,然后点击“Directories”,可以配置编译器和工具的路径。例如,如果使用的是GCC编译器,需要将GCC的可执行文件路径添加到“Executables”选项卡中。此外,还可以在“Commands”选项卡中配置编译、调试等命令,以便在SourceInsight中直接调用编译器和工具。

4.编码格式设置

不同的代码文件可能采用不同的编码格式,如UTF-8、GBK等。为了确保SourceInsight能正确显示和处理代码,需要设置编码格式。在菜单栏中选择“Options”,点击“FileTypeOptions”,在“Encoding”选项中选择合适的编码格式。如果项目中的代码文件编码格式不一致,可以选择“Auto-detectencoding”让SourceInsight自动检测。

二、SourceInsight如何进行个性化定制

1.界面布局定制

SourceInsight的界面布局可以根据个人喜好进行调整。通过拖动窗口边缘或使用菜单栏中的“Window”选项,可以调整各个窗口的大小和位置。例如,可以将符号窗口、文件窗口和代码编辑窗口进行合理布局,以便同时查看多个信息。此外,还可以通过“Options”菜单中的“Preferences”选项,选择不同的界面主题,如浅色主题或深色主题,以满足不同的视觉需求。

2.快捷键设置

为了提高操作效率,可以对SourceInsight的快捷键进行个性化设置。在菜单栏中选择“Options”,点击“KeyAssignments”,可以查看和修改现有的快捷键。如果某个操作没有对应的快捷键,还可以自定义快捷键。例如,可以将常用的“查找”“替换”等操作设置为自己熟悉的快捷键组合,这样在操作时就能更加便捷。

3.代码高亮与字体设置

代码高亮可以使代码更加清晰易读。在菜单栏中选择“Options”,点击“SyntaxHighlighting”,可以对不同类型的代码元素(如关键字、注释、字符串等)设置不同的颜色和字体样式。同时,还可以在“Preferences”选项中设置代码编辑区域的字体和字号,以满足个人的阅读习惯。

4.自动完成与代码模板设置

SourceInsight的自动完成功能可以提高代码输入速度。在“Options”菜单的“Preferences”选项中,可以调整自动完成的触发条件和显示方式。此外,还可以创建代码模板,将常用的代码片段保存为模板。在编写代码时,只需输入模板名称,SourceInsight就会自动插入相应的代码片段,大大提高了代码编写效率。

三、解决SourceInsight中代码注释自动换行问题

1.问题描述

在使用SourceInsight编写代码时,当注释内容较长时,可能会出现注释不能自动换行的情况,这会影响代码的整体美观和可读性。

2.原因分析

SourceInsight默认的设置可能没有开启注释自动换行功能,或者相关的参数设置不合理,导致注释超出编辑区域后不会自动换行。

3.解决方案

修改配置文件

SourceInsight的配置信息存储在配置文件中,可以通过修改配置文件来解决注释自动换行问题。首先,找到SourceInsight的安装目录,在该目录下找到“utils.em”文件,使用文本编辑器打开该文件。在文件中搜索“DefaultCommentFormat”,这是注释格式的相关设置。在对应的设置项中添加“Wrap”参数,例如:

DefaultCommentFormat={

Prefix="//";

Wrap=80;//设置换行宽度为80个字符

}

修改完成后保存文件,重新启动SourceInsight,注释应该就会自动换行了。

使用插件

除了修改配置文件,还可以使用一些第三方插件来实现注释自动换行功能。在互联网上搜索相关的SourceInsight插件,下载并安装合适的插件。安装完成后,按照插件的说明进行配置,即可实现注释自动换行。

4.验证与调整

修改配置文件或安装插件后,打开一个包含较长注释的代码文件进行验证。如果注释仍然没有自动换行,检查配置文件中的参数设置是否正确,或者插件是否安装和配置成功。可以根据实际情况调整换行宽度等参数,以达到最佳的显示效果。

四、总结

SourceInsight作为一款强大的代码分析和编辑工具,通过正确的环境配置和个性化定制,能够更好地满足开发者的需求,提高工作效率。在环境配置方面,要注意软件安装、项目创建与代码导入、编译器与工具配置以及编码格式设置等环节,确保SourceInsight能正常运行并正确处理代码。在个性化定制方面,界面布局、快捷键、代码高亮、自动完成和代码模板等设置可以根据个人喜好进行调整,使操作更加便捷和舒适。

同时,在使用SourceInsight的过程中,可能会遇到一些具体的技术问题,如代码注释自动换行问题。通过深入分析问题原因,并采取合适的解决方案,如修改配置文件或使用插件,能够有效地解决这些问题,提升使用体验。

总之,掌握SourceInsight的环境配置和个性化定制方法,以及解决常见技术问题的能力,对于开发者来说是非常重要的。希望本文的介绍能帮助读者更好地使用SourceInsight,在软件开发和代码分析工作中取得更好的成果。

读者也访问过这里:
135 2431 0251